Spindlin1 (SPIN1) is a transcriptional coactivator with critical functions in embryonic
development and emerging roles in cancer. SPIN1 harbors three Tudor domains, two of
which engage the tail of histone H3 by reading the H3–Lys-4 trimethylation and H3–Arg-8
asymmetric dimethylation marks. To gain mechanistic insight into how SPIN1 functions as a
transcriptional coactivator, here we purified its interacting proteins. We identified an
uncharacterized protein (C11orf84), which we renamed SPIN1 docking protein (SPIN· DOC) …
